LCP is an award-winning consultancy providing advice on pensions, investments, insurance, energy, health analytics and employee benefits.
What our team do
The Risk Benefits Consulting (RBC) practice is a long established and successful department, based in London.
We provide advice to both corporate clients and trustees on a range of health and well-being employee benefits. We manage the design, broking and administration of;
We design, price and place insurance with a range of insurers for both new and existing arrangements.
